what we do. We have unwavering loyalty to our DNA, our culture, our values, and ourselves. Website Links: PTW | Leading QA, Localization & Player......
Job Location: Bangalore, Karnataka, IndiaSelected articles on work and employment, which may be found interesting:
5 ways to overcome the fear of job changeFind more articles on Articles page